Federal Shariat Court Strikes Down 2022 Legislation Decriminalising Suicide Attempts

Federal Shariat Court strikes down suicide attempts decriminalisation law restoring Section 325 PPC Pakistan May 18 2026 ruling un-Islamic

Pakistan’s Federal Shariat Court has reversed one of the country’s most significant recent mental health law reforms  ruling that the 2022 legislation decriminalising suicide attempts was un-Islamic and striking it down entirely. The verdict, announced Monday by a three-member bench, restores Section 325 of the Pakistan Penal Code  making attempted suicide a criminal offence once […]

Local Government System in Pakistan: History, Structure, and the Fight for Real Devolution

Local government system in Pakistan — elected representatives at a union council meeting

The local government system in Pakistan represents the third tier of governance, below the federal and provincial levels. Despite constitutional guarantees under Article 140-A, local bodies have repeatedly been weakened, dissolved, or left without elections for years. Pakistan Flood 2025: NDMA Flood Alert, Affected Areas, Facts and Figures

Flood-affected area in Pakistan 2025 showing submerged villages and displaced families amid NDMA relief operations

The flood in Pakistan 2025 has emerged as one of the most devastating natural disasters in the country’s recent history. According to figures compiled by the National Disaster Management Authority (NDMA), the 2025 floods claimed at least 1,000 lives and affected nearly seven million people across the country.
